Transaction 96521213fcc96b81cf5511658e50a57f57e25d993d61bb3fa5098f60ff42bce1
1 Input
1 Output
-
96521213fcc96b81cf5511658e50a57f57e25d993d61bb3fa5098f60ff42bce1:0
- value
- 5337
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a287ee493f03fd9ea39a1a06e4a4139ae9b9363
- address
- bc1q3g58aeyn7qlan63e5xsxujjp8xhfhymrd75aqr